About this property

Pinewoods Springs Lodge with Tower, 240 forested acres & 1 acre Pond

Exquisitely restored antique barn with all wood interior and original stonework. There are 5 unique bedrooms, 4 on the ground floor of the Lodge each with its own private, full bathroom and the 5th bedroom is located on the 2nd floor of thr Tower..
The upstairs of the Lodge is a large open concept area including; the full kitchen, lovely dining area, pool table, board games, cozy TV area with 3D television, fireplace, and woodstove and a half bath.
The Tower is three stories also all wood interior.
The first floor has a pool table, couch, rocker love seat and chairs. There is also a half bathroom with toilet and sink.
The second floor has 4 twin beds and a lovely view.
And finally, the third & top floor of the Tower offers the most amazing views especially sunrise/sunset and storms.Panoramic views and nice space to visit with family and friends, do yoga, or look through the telescope.
The 240 Acre property has 30 acres of fields, an apple orchard and the rest is a diverse forest with beautiful trails for exploring, on foot, by cross country ski or snow shoe and are even wide enough for ATVs. The is also a 1 acre pond for swimming or go for a ride on the paddle boat. There are some small fish if you want to toss in a line.
Ample firewood provided for bonfire and our location, far from light pollution, make for incredible views of the stars, meteor showers or Northern lights.
The large paved parking and turnaround area in front of the Lodge are perfect for vehicles with trailers.
